INFLUENCE OF HEATING AND COOLING RATES ON BACILLUS CEREUS SPORE SURVIVAL AND GROWTH IN A BROTH MEDIUM AND IN RICE.

Author(s) : JOHNSON K. M., NELSON C. L., BUSTA F. F.

Type of article: Article

Summary

SURVIVAL, SPORE GERMINATION, AND GROWTH OF EMETIC AND DIARRHEAL TYPE STRAINS OF BACILLUS CEREUS WERE EVALUATED IN BROTH AND RICE MEDIA DURING HEATING AND COOLING. SAMPLES WERE HEATED TO 353 K (80 DEG C) (20 OR 40 K/HR) OR 363 K (90 DEG C) (CA. 900 K/H), PRIOR TO COOLING TO 283 K (10 DEG C) (5 OR 10 K/HR). FOLLOWING HEATING TO 353 K, GROWTH OCCURRED DURING 5 K/HR COOLING. AFTER HEATING TO 363 K, INACTIVATION OF THREE STRAINS OCCURRED DURING COOLING FROM 363 TO 353 K AND AGAIN FROM 323 TO 313 K (50 TO 40 DEG C). GREAT VARIABILITY WAS OBSERVED AMONG THE RESPONSES OF THE FOUR STRAINS.
